Linen and Turnover Kits Market Outlook (2025 to 2035)
The global linen and turnover kits market was valued at USD 1,236 million in 2024 and has been forecasted to expand at a noteworthy CAGR of 7.3% to end up at USD 2,684 million by 2035.
Linen and turnover kits are very important materials within various industries that include hospitality, health, and manufacturing. A linen kit is one that is designed and put together with all elements that would be required in a particular setting, which include sheets, towels, pillowcases, and tablecloths to assist in cleaning and maintaining hygiene for hotels, hospitals, and restaurants. These linens are washed, sanitized, and changed regularly for the comfort of customers or patients.
A turnover kit is a supply package used by cleaning personnel or housekeeping teams that is designed to rapidly and effectively ready rooms or areas for new occupants. It would typically include fresh linens, toiletries, cleaning supplies, and replacement items in both the beds and bathrooms.
For industries like hospitality, a turnover kit contributes to smoothing out the operation by reducing preparation time per room, hence allowing for seamless guest service. In all industries, these kits stand ready and well-organized for smooth operations. They save time, maintain hygiene standards, and improve overall efficiency, contributing to the seamless functioning of hotels, hospitals, restaurants, and more.
- Sales of turnover kits in 2025 are estimated at USD 740.3 million, and the segment will account for 55.8% of the overall linen and turnover kits market share in 2025
- The polyester material segment is estimated to be worth USD 321.1 million in 2025 and will account for 24.2% share of the market

Sales Analysis of Linen and Turnover Kits (2020 to 2024) vs. Market Forecasts (2025 to 2035)
The value of the linen and turnover kits market was USD 913 million in 2020 and it increased to USD 1,236 million by 2024, expanding at a CAGR of 7.9%.
- Short Term (2025 to 2028): Growth in demand for linen and turnover kits is expected to arise from both the hospitality and healthcare sectors, as increased traveling and tourism raise the need for linens, while the raised bar on hygiene will enforce the usage of turnover kits. The contribution of technological innovations in fabric materials will also contribute towards demand.
- Medium Term (2028 to 2032): The market will profit from the increased automation of processes related to laundry and cleaning. Sustainable and eco-friendly fabrics will be more commonly used, helping businesses by reducing costs and appealing to clients who are environmentally conscious. The expansion of healthcare services will be another contributing factor, because hospitals will need more linen and turnover kits to maintain cleanliness and quality patient care.
- Long Term (2032 to 2035): An upsurge in population and increased urbanization, especially in developing countries, will drive the linen and turnover kits market. With increasing travel and expansion of health services, the demand for better linens and cleaning solutions will increase. Automation and intelligent inventory systems will make operations smoother and reduce costs for the companies providing these kits.

What are the Challenges Encountered by Manufacturers of Linen and Turnover Kits?
“Effectively Handling Disruptions in the Supply Chain and Shortages of Inventory is a Concern for the Manufacturers”
Among the major challenges manufacturers of linen and turnover kits face are supply chain disruptions and material shortages. These may be due to global shipping delays, labor shortages, or problems at key raw material suppliers.
When a manufacturer depends on materials such as cotton, polyester, or specialized fabrics for healthcare linens, any disruption in these material's supply causes delays in production. For example, if a cotton crop is poor because of weather or if containers are delayed at the various ports, this creates a shortage of the fabric used in bed sheets, towels, and other items included in the turnover kits.
Delays and shortages cause problems at the manufacturer level, which is supposed to work on very tight deadlines, particularly in industries such as hospitality and healthcare, where turnover kits and linens are always in demand.
Increased costs may be incurred at the manufacturer's end in their effort to seek other suppliers or suffer a compromise in quality if substitute materials have to be used. Eventually, this reflects in their inability to fulfill customer demands in time, thus affecting their reputation and profitability.

Why is Adoption of Linen and Turnover Kits High in the United States?
“Strict Standards for Hygiene and Infection Control drive the Adoption of Turnover kits in United States”
The market in the United States is estimated at USD 141 million in 2025 and is projected to expand at a CAGR of 7.7% through 2035. Strict standards of hygiene and infection control in the healthcare and hospitality sectors in the United States significantly fuel the demand for linen and turnover kits.
This is because both industries need to maintain high cleanliness levels for their patients and guests against contracting infections. In hospitals, nursing homes, and all other health facilities, disinfection prevents cross-contamination and is essential for patient care. The use of fresh linens, towels, and disposable items in turnover kits provides each patient or guest with a clean, sanitized environment.
Similarly, every guest expects their rooms to be not only clean but also free from any sort of contaminant in the case of hotels and resorts. A turnover kit contains all that may be needed to prepare a room: fresh sheets, towels, toiletries-all help the housekeeping teams maintain the cleanliness as fast and neat as possible between guest stays.
